Luzhi, located in Jiangsu Province, is a must-visit destination for several compelling reasons:
1. Historical Charm: With a history dating back over 2,500 years, Luzhi is one of the oldest towns in the Yangtze River Delta region, offering a glimpse into ancient Chinese culture and architecture.
2. Preserved Ancient Town: The town has well-preserved ancient buildings, including traditional residential houses, bridges, and streets, which provide a unique experience of the water town lifestyle.
3. Cultural Heritage: Luzhi is known for its rich cultural heritage, including the famous "Luzhi Chant," a form of oral literature that has been passed down through generations.
4. Scenic Beauty: The town is surrounded by waterways and greenery, offering picturesque views and a serene environment that is perfect for relaxation and photography.
5. Local Cuisine: Visitors can enjoy the authentic taste of Jiangsu cuisine, with local specialties such as "Luzhi Rice Wine" and "Luzhi Cured Fish."
6. Artisanal Crafts: The town is famous for its traditional crafts, including bamboo weaving, embroidery, and pottery, which are still practiced by local artisans.
7. Festivals and Events: Luzhi hosts various cultural festivals and events throughout the year, providing opportunities to experience local customs and traditions.
8. Accessibility: Situated near major cities like Suzhou and Shanghai, Luzhi is easily accessible by various modes of transportation, making it a convenient day trip or weekend getaway.
9. Ecological Environment: The town is known for its commitment to environmental protection, offering a clean and green space away from the hustle and bustle of urban life.
10. Educational Value: Luzhi serves as an open-air museum, providing educational opportunities for visitors to learn about traditional Chinese architecture, history, and culture.
